Debt-free Balance SheetZero reported debt materially reduces bankruptcy and interest-rate risk, giving management durable financial flexibility to pursue exploration, asset sales or capital raises on more favorable terms. This conservatism supports survival while operating losses continue.
Moderating Cash BurnA reduction in cash burn versus the prior year indicates improving expense control or narrower operating losses. If sustained, this trend lowers future external financing needs, extends runway, and increases the chance management can reach a break-even or stable funding position.
Improving Loss Run-rateAn improving annual loss run-rate suggests operational adjustments or cost discipline that are beginning to reduce recurring losses. Sustained improvement would strengthen long-term viability by shrinking cumulative deficit and easing pressure on shareholder equity.
